Benefits of UPVC Panels Before diving into the renovation process, it's advantageous to comprehend why UPVC panels are a popular option:
Durability: UPVC panels are resistant to corrosion, rot, and deterioration from sunlight, making them a lasting alternative for various applications.
Low Maintenance: Unlike wood or other materials that require regular treatment, UPVC panels are easy to tidy and maintain.
Affordable: The initial investment in UPVC panels is offset by their durability and low maintenance expenses, leading to cost savings gradually.
Versatile Design: Available in various colors, textures, and finishes, UPVC panels can imitate the appearance of genuine wood or other materials, providing visual appeal without the drawbacks.
Insulation Properties: UPVC panels offer excellent thermal insulation, contributing to energy effectiveness in structures.
Actions for UPVC Panel Renovation Refurbishing UPVC panels can breathe brand-new life into a structure while maintaining its core integrity. The list below steps detail an extensive guide to UPVC panel renovation:
Step 1: Assessment Determine the level of wear or damage to the UPVC panels:
Check for staining, scratches, or dents. Look for signs of moisture retention or mold development. Assess whether the damage is shallow or structural. Step 2: Cleaning Thorough cleaning is important to prepare the panels for further renovation:
Cleaning Process:
Gather Materials: You will require a soft brush, sponge, vacuum cleaner, moderate detergent, and water.
Eliminate Surface Debris: Use a soft brush or vacuum cleaner to eliminate dust and debris.
Wash the Panels: Mix mild cleaning agent with water and scrub the panels carefully with a sponge, focusing on stained or unclean locations.
Rinse and Dry: Rinse completely with clean water and allow the panels to dry totally.
Action 3: Repairing Damage When the panels are clean, assess any damage:
Scratches and Scuffs: Use a UPVC repair package to complete scratches or scuffs. Follow the maker's guidelines to apply filler and sand it down for a smooth surface.
Dents or Cracks: For more serious damage, think about utilizing a heat weapon to soften the UPVC and reshape it if possible. Additionally, patches can be applied utilizing UPVC adhesive and brand-new panel product.
Step 4: Repainting or Refurbishing For panels that have lost their color or aesthetic appeal, repainting can be an ideal choice:
Select the Right Paint: Use paint specifically developed for UPVC. Avoid regular wall paints that might not adhere well.
Apply Primer: If essential, apply a guide appropriate for UPVC to boost adhesion.
Painting Process: Use a premium brush or roller to apply an even coat of paint, guaranteeing the coverage is uniform.
Drying Time: Allow the paint to dry according to the item's requirements. A 2nd coat may be required for a richer color.
Step 5: Sealing and Finishing When painting is complete, ensure that the panels are sealed properly:
Check Seals and Joints: Inspect silicone or sealant around panels. Replace or repair as essential to avoid water or air ingress.
Final Clean: Wipe down the panels with a moist cloth, eliminating any paint splatters or residue.
Action 6: Regular Maintenance To guarantee the durability of UPVC panels, regular maintenance ought to become part of the renovation plan:
Clean panels every couple of months with a mild detergent. Examine seals and joints every year, fixing as needed. Avoid abrasive cleaners that can damage the surface area. Regularly Asked Questions 1. How frequently should UPVC panels be renovated? UPVC panels normally need renovation every 5 to 10 years, depending upon direct exposure to sunlight, weather condition conditions, and maintenance practices.
2. Can UPVC panels be painted? Yes, UPVC panels can be painted using specifically created paints developed for plastic materials. Appropriate cleansing and preparation are important for adherence.
3. Are UPVC panels ecologically friendly? UPVC can be recycled, and when correctly preserved, it has a long life-span, adding to lower environmental effect compared to more organic materials that require frequent replacement.
4. What are the signs that I need to refurbish my UPVC panels? Signs consist of discoloration, cracks, water damage, mold development, and basic deterioration of the panels.
5. Is expert help essential for UPVC panel renovation? While lots of homeowners can DIY, working with a specialist may be useful for extensive repairs or if you're unsure about the renovation process.
